Why the UKGC is the Strictest Regulator
The UK Gambling Commission is universally recognized as the most strict, demanding, and player-focused regulator on the planet.
The UKGC forces casinos to integrate with national self-exclusion registers (like GamStop) to fiercely protect gambling addicts.

The Malta Gaming Authority (MGA)
While the UKGC only protects British citizens, the Malta Gaming Authority (MGA) serves as the primary regulator for the rest of Europe.
The MGA requires incredibly strict software fairness testing, ensuring that the RNGs cannot be manipulated by the casino.
